Dynamics of nonlinear stochastic operators and associated Markov measures

Abstract

The aim of this paper is to examine the stability of a class of nonlinear stochastic operators on a finite‐dimensional simplex. We identify a number of properties of the set of the class of stochastic operators, including the stability of each operator. We then use these operators to define non‐homogeneous Markov measures that rely on initial data and carry out an investigation into the absolute continuity and singularity of these measures.
